shivakumarEncrypted Storage — AndroidIn this blog we will learn how to implement/use encryption to save local data in Android.Feb 8Feb 8
shivakumarKotlin Flows — Backoff and Retry StrategyIn this blog we will learn how to implement back-off and retry request with Kotlin flows.Aug 7, 20231Aug 7, 20231
shivakumarWebview in Compose AndroidIn this blog we will learn how to create webview with Jetpack Compose. You can view webpages and can send intent to external browsers to…Jul 31, 2023Jul 31, 2023
shivakumarNavigation In Jetpack ComposeIn this blog we will learn how to perform navigate with Jetpack Compose. You can navigate between composables while taking advantage of the…Jun 14, 2023Jun 14, 2023
shivakumarJetpack Compose BasicsIn this blog we will try to look at all the basics and fundamental blocks needed to start Jetpack Compose.Jun 13, 2023Jun 13, 2023
shivakumarCoroutine scope vs Supervisor scopeIn this blog we will learn about the difference between Coroutine scope and supervisor scope. This will be short read as the differences…Jun 13, 20231Jun 13, 20231
shivakumarLaunch vs Async in Kotlin CoroutinesIn this blog we will learn about when we want to use coroutines for networking/suspending functions. There are 2 approaches.Jun 13, 20231Jun 13, 20231
shivakumarA Quick Comparison between React Native Apps vs Native Apps(Android/iOS).It is no surprise that the marketing trends, tactics, and technologies have drastically changed more in the last five years than in the…Feb 22, 2022Feb 22, 2022